When comparing life insurance quotes, there are a few key factors to consider. The first is the type of policy you’re looking for. There are two main types of life insurance: term and whole life. Term life insurance provides coverage for a specific period of time, usually 10-30 years, while whole life insurance provides coverage for your entire life. Independent talent agents may benefit more from term life insurance, as it tends to be more affordable and can provide coverage during the years when they are most active in their careers.

First and foremost, it’s important to understand the different types of life insurance policies available. There are two main types: term life insurance and whole life insurance. Term life insurance provides coverage for a specific period of time, usually 10, 20, or 30 years. Whole life insurance, on the other hand, provides coverage for your entire life and also includes a cash value component that grows over time.

When comparing life insurance quotes, be sure to look at the coverage amount, premium cost, and any additional benefits or riders offered. Some policies may offer additional benefits such as accelerated death benefits, which allow you to access a portion of your death benefit if you are diagnosed with a terminal illness. Other policies may offer riders such as accidental death or disability coverage.

It’s also important to consider the financial stability and reputation of the insurance company. Look for a company with a strong financial rating and a good track record of paying claims.
